State Secretary of the Belarusian Security Council Aleksandr Volfovich is attending the annual meeting of the secretaries of the Security Councils of the CIS countries in Moscow, BelTA has learned.

In his video address to the participants of the event, Russian President Vladimir Putin stated that regular meetings of the secretaries of the Security Councils are important for strengthening collective security in the CIS. According to him, the participants of the meeting will discuss the situation in the CIS region and in the world, outline joint steps to counter modern challenges and threats. The secretaries of the Security Council will also discuss ways of ensuring social and political stability in the CIS in the context of growing external threats and a number of other topical issues.

The annual meeting of the secretaries of the Security Councils of the CIS member states is held for the 11th time. The previous one took place in the Russian capital in November 2022.
